Lake Shore Central Schools (Evans-Brant Central School District)
TRANSPORTATION REQUESTS DUENew York State Education law requires that requests for special transportation be filed with local Boards of Education by April 1st each year.
Private Parochial Request Forms are available on our website, www.lakeshorecsd.org, under “Services”, “Transportation Services”, and click on “Forms”. Once the proper form is completed, it should be submitted to the District’s Transportation Office located at 8710 North Main Street, Angola, NY 14006. This announcement has been published to alert parents of such students, or prospective students, to inquire as to the procedure to be used if they are not clear relative to the required April 1 annual transportation request filing deadline. Parents who have questions concerning filing procedures for schools within the 15-mile transportation limit, which is established by New York State Education Law, should contact Perry Oddi, Transportation Supervisor at 926-2241.

SCHOOL TRANSFERS FOR NATIVE AMERICAN STUDENTS
Pursuant to an agreement between the New York State Education Department and the Lake Shore (Evans-Brant) Central School District, Native American children residing within the Cat-taraugus Reservation may attend the Lake Shore Central Schools by filing an application for transfer by April 15th each year. Such application for September enrollment shall be effective upon approval by the Lake Shore Superintendent, which approval or denial and the reasons therefore shall be set forth in writing. The state shall provide transportation for any child trans-ferring under this section.
All requests for the transfer of Native American children residing within the Cattaraugus Reser-vation should be addressed to James Przepasniak, Superintendent of Schools, Lake Shore Cen-tral Schools, 959 Beach Road, Angola, NY 14006, by April 15th.

Monarch Butterflies Could Get Endangered Species Status
Every year, millions of North American Monarch butter-flies head south for the winter - but their numbers have plummeted by up to 90 percent. The U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service recently announced a year-long review that could mean that the butterflies are placed on the Endangered Species List. Brilliant orange and black Manarchs are among the most easily recognizable of the butterfly Species which call the Americas home. Their migration takes them as far north as Canada and, during the winter months, as far south as Mexico City. A single Monarch can travel hundreds and thousands of miles. Monarchs are truly spectacular migrants, because the butterflies know the correct direction to migrate even though they have never made the journey before. They fol-low an internal “compass” that points them in the right direction each spring and fall. The Monarch migration is one of the greatest natural phenomena in the insect world. The federal government says the loss of milkweed - the Monarch caterpillar’s only food source - and pesticide ex-posure are among the top threats to the species. (Some es-timate that the number of milkweed plants has declined by as much as 80% with widespread spraying of weed killer.) The Evans Garden Club will be distributing Milkweed seeds at the Environmental Fair at the Evans Center Fire Hall on Saturday, March 28, and at other locations in weeks to come.

Nickel City Race Club Sends 10 Swimmers to Niagara LSC
Championship Swim Meet The Niagara LSC Championship Swim Meet was held on March 12-15 in Webster, NY. The Niagara LSC which comprises most of upstate NY held its annual short course Championship meet, drawing a meet record 936 qualifying swimmers, representing over 60 USA Swimming age group swim clubs from around the area. The team high score award went to a well-coached and talented Victor Swim Club (located southeast of Rochester). Nickel City Race Club swimmer athletes had several great performances over the weekend. Solid swims for personal best times were logged by Casey Aquiline, Lauren Aquiline and Livvy Heltz. Stand out performers at the swim meet for Nickel City Race Club were: Colin Herzog (12) recorded time drops in 12 races mark-ing a team high 10 Niagara LSC zone cut times for the season. Topping Colin’s Swims were the 200 IM (2:19.9), the 50 Free (25.9) and the 200 Back (2:21). Nick Herzog (16) Registered several technically sound races in the 200 IM (2:02.8), 400 IM (4:22.5), 200 Free (1:50.7), 200 Back (2:08.6), and 200 Fly (2:07.7). Logging several personal bests and achieving Niagara Zone Team cut times while making the A finals in his shortened sea-son. Morgan Matyas (10) Nickel City Race Club’s high point scorer showcased her swimming abilities while posting personal best times in every race and achieving her first Niagara Zone Team cut time in the 50 Back (35.7), while completing fast races in the 50 Free (30.3), 100 Free (1:05.9) & 200 Free (2:26.4). Paige Pasquarella (14) A consistent performer for NCRC, posted strong results in qualifying for the A final in 100 Free and posting a personal best (56.3) in what was a highly competitive event. Gritty performances were also posted in the 50 Free (26.5) and 200 Free (2:05.7) in what is a very competitive age group. LSC Championship meet rookies Johnny Mallory (9) and Henry Roberts (10) made sure they got a taste of compe-tition at this higher level and are poised to be perennial future standouts. Nickel City Race Club, a premier USA Swimming team practices year round in Hamburg (Frontier), Evans (Lake Shore) and South Buffalo (Cazenovia Pool) and is taking new registrations for the Mid April - Late June Spring ses-sion at www.NickelCItyRaceClub.com.

THIS IS A HAMMERBy Samantha Mazzotta
Take Stock For SpringWith the long freeze and snowy conditions that the eastern part of the country has dealt with this winter, it may be hard to believe that spring is on its way. But in southerly parts, signs of spring are already appear-ing. Regardless of whether you’re still shoveling snow, or watching buds blossom, it’s time to start preparing for the busy spring season.Here are a few things to add to your to-do list over the next few weeks:• Take stock: Check your garage or storage shed to make sure you have all the tools and supplies needed to prep the lawn and garden. Things like grass seed for treating brown or thin spots, fertilizer, and lawn tools like thatchers and rakes.• Prepare your lawnmower and power tools: Make sure the mower is assembled, that blades are sharp and that you have fresh fuel on hand. Check that power tools like edgers, blowers, string trim-mers and hedge trimmers are in good shape.• Turn your compost pile: Or, if you don’t have one, start one. It won’t be ready for early spring but could be usable in the summer to help along your vegetable
garden.• Get outdoor furniture ready: Whether your patio furniture is stored or sturdy enough to sit outside all win-ter, check it for damage and clean off dirt, mineral scal-ing or other crud.• Check window and door screens: Replacing a torn or ratty screen is one of the easiest and most affordable DIY jobs.• Inspect your lawn for dam-age: Freezing weather, icy patches and salt-burnt edg-ing are among the problems homeowners often fi nd after the snow melts. You can be-gin patching up damaged ar-
eas even before the last hardfrost.• Make a budget: List thesupplies and tools you need,plus repairs. Also budgethow much time you candedicate to home and gardenwork this year.
TIP: Help salt-damagedgrass and plants recover bywatering them thoroughlyonce the weather is consis-tently above freezing, thenre-seeding and treating withappropriate fertilizer.

COUCH THEATERDVD PREVIEWS
By Sam Struckhoff
PICKS OF THE WEEK“The Immigrant” (R) -- Ewa (Marion Coutillard) and her sister make the harrowing journey to Ellis Island from their home in Poland, only to be told that their immigration would end there. A smooth-talking and enigmatic busi-nessman (Joaquin Phoenix) happens to be at the immi-gration offi ce, and he says he can get them onto Manhattan. The catch is that the innocent and demure Ewa must work for him as a dancer and pros-titute. In the darkness of her situation, Ewa catches a fl ash of hope coming from a dap-per stage magician (Jeremy Renner).The story is engaging and heartrending, staying visually stylistic without ever melting into melodramatic bluster. The light and mood coming from the picture captures an-other world, and it might as well be a 1921 New York. It’s a slow, serious drama with an emotional pay off.
“Pelican Dreams” (G) -- Just a few years back, a pelican caused a commotion on San Francisco’s storied Golden Gate Bridge. She was wan-dering the bridge, injured, lost, confused and in need of help. She was swooped up, taken to a shelter and named “Gigi.” Gigi’s story of rescue and the humans helping her rehabilitate is the main draw for this curious and thought-ful documentary about the big birds.It turns out that pelicans have a lot going on, more than enough to keep kids and adults paying attention and caring for an 80-minute run time. They’re meant to be out in the wild, but they can become peculiarly dog-like when they spend too much
time with people. Still, pel-icans are not pets, and those who can’t rejoin the wild world often meet with eu-thanasia -- raising the stakes for those of us who develop a soft spot for the awkward little guys on-screen.
“The Invisible Front” (Not Rated) -- As German power faded in eastern Europe to-ward the end of World War II, Soviet occupation became the new threat to the many people who favored demo-cratic government, or who had suffered during com-munist occupation earlier in the war. This documentary takes a very personal look at a Lithuanian resistance group that would come to be known as “The Forest Broth-ers.” The fi lmmakers craft a riveting story with the letters,
photographs and living testi-monials from those who werethere.
“Happy Valley” (Not Rated) -- Penn State football andJoe Paterno enjoyed yearsof praise and success, untilthe child abuse scandal thatcame to light in 2011 turned a college football program intoa fi restorm. This documenta-ry takes a keen focus on the reaction and impact in thecommunity that idolized Pa-terno and Penn State football.Some people just denied, oth-er raged or pointed fi ngers. There were plenty of pub-lic meltdowns, even a full-blown riot. It’s an uncom-fortable line of thinking, butone worth following -- how should a community respond when there’s something trulyugly to confront?

TO YOUR GOOD HEALTH
By Keith Roach, M.D.
No Quick Fix For Belly FatDEAR DR. ROACH: I am an old man (84) with a mid-dle-age paunch (5 feet, 7 inches tall and weigh 200 pounds) who needs to fi t into a suit with pants an inch too tight in time for a wedding in a few weeks. About how many pounds do I need to lose to fi t into them? Is there any formula for converting waist inches to pounds? And are there exercises or other means to focus the weight loss on belly fat? -- Anon.ANSWER: I am afraid there’s no formula. Fur-ther, I have to tell you that weight doesn’t always come off where we want it to, and specifi c exercises aren’t go-ing to make the fat come off in those locations.The good news is that for most people, especially men, the fi rst 10 pounds or so to come off usually comes from the middle. The fat in the omentum (an apron-shaped structure inside the abdomen) is metabolically active and often is the fi rst place where fat is gained or lost. Moreover, that fat is the most likely to increase risk of heart disease. So losing weight around your middle is a good way of improving overall health, especially if you have more inches there than you’d like.Often people start a healthy diet and exercise program and fi nd that the waist size decreases but their weight stays the same. That may be because muscle is much heavier than fat, and the increase in muscle mass makes up for the loss of fat. More muscle is good for you; less body fat is good for you. Weight is an imperfect measure.
Liposuction can remove fat from around your waist, but a healthy diet and regular exercise will make you feel better and quite possibly live longer.***DEAR DR. ROACH: I in-jured my little fi nger in an athletic event. The end of my pinky pointed in toward the ring fi nger. It is black and blue, and swollen. Do you think I fractured it? Should I get an X-ray? I am still able to curl my fi nger. -- A.J.ANSWER: It’s most likely that you damaged one of the tendons in the fi nger. Some-times a fracture can happen at the same time. Most often, these are treated conserva-tively, with ice right after the injury and the fi nger splinted in a straight position for up to six weeks. Only an expe-rienced physician, such as a hand surgeon, can provide
exact recommendations.***DEAR DR. ROACH: Whenyou are instructed to takemedicine, vitamin, etc., onan empty stomach, how longafter eating should you wait?Also, if taken before eating,how long after you take themedication until you caneat? -- B.H.ANSWER: It depends onthe particular medication.For example, the osteopo-rosis drug alendronate (Fos-amax) should be taken afteran overnight fast, with plainwater (even mineral watercan affect its absorption)and then no food for a half hour. Different medications have different requirements.Your pharmacist remainsyour best resource, and of-ten has both more trainingand experience than doctors.In general, most vitaminsshould be taken with food.
